Output 43a5c70d63c22bcf5f10da22e73150ef46cefe4c76b2afb8afa340ea64d29d1e:7

value
18469048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24878d80d8d92eeddb8a1787c45dffc43e92d0bf OP_EQUAL
address
352AdpVYWrwmTBHNyFprjtF2B6yds6iKGe
transaction
43a5c70d63c22bcf5f10da22e73150ef46cefe4c76b2afb8afa340ea64d29d1e
spent
true